Scott Hansen: All Blacks assistant coach on the team's victory over the Wallabies 29.09.2024 9:49
The All Blacks have bounced back again and beaten out the Wallabies at Wellington's Sky Stadium. The team walked away with a 33-13 win - setting a record for coach Scott Robertson's first year. Despite the victory, assistant coach Scott Hansen says there's room for improvement ahead of the team's end of year tour. LISTEN ABOVE See omnystudio.com/listener for privacy information.
Jake Duke: Fox Sports Journalist on the NRL Grand Final, Melbourne Storm's dominating season 28.09.2024 11:39
The Melbourne Storm are through to yet another NRL Grand Final. They dispatched the Sydney Roosters in the Preliminary Final, beating them 48-18. Grant Sharman: Former Coach for the Wheel Blacks discusses the team's 2004 Paralympic Gold Medal in Athens 21.09.2024 10:35
Two decades, a simple team talk and a gold medal. This weekend the 2004 Wheel Blacks are reuniting to celebrate their feat from 20 years ago at the Athens Paralympics, when they won wheelchair rugby gold.
